And the really sad part is that a WI spinner is better than the Indian ones and at the moment WI spin attack consisting of Naraine & Bishoo will be better than what we can muster [/quote'] No spinner has stood out this time apart from Narine due his mystery and he has bowled mostly at Eden is still unknown and the reason is the pitches this time around has been flatter than past editions apart from Eden. Even Chennai pitch has not helped spinners. Spinners are not getting the purchase from the pitches they used to get. This time we have seen so many pitches with grass covering on them. Delhi, Mumbai, Mohali, Hyderabad, Bengalore even Pune and Jaipur...all had grass on them...Even Chennai had grass covering on most of the tracks.
